titleOfInvention | Immersion medium holding mechanism, immersion objective lens and manufacturing method thereof |
abstract | When observing and measuring a sample, the immersion medium supplied to the tip of the objective lens may be spilled from the tip of the objective lens even when the amount of movement for the measurement is large or for a long time. Provided are an immersion objective lens, an immersion medium holding mechanism, and a manufacturing method thereof. An immersion objective lens is formed of a tip portion, a lens ring portion, and a lens outer frame, and the lens ring portion is composed of the entire inclined surface from the lens at the tip portion to the lens outer frame 10, and the immersion objective lens. In the region including the front end portion of the lens and the lens ring portion, the immersion medium is held which is a region surface-treated with the first material for holding the immersion medium in a ring shape so as to surround the front end portion of the lens. The affinity of the first ring-shaped member (α portion) to the immersion medium is lower than the affinity of the region connected to the inside of the surface-treated region to the immersion medium.
